From creating treasure maps to helping children find pen pals, geared to children from 5 to 10 years of age, this illustrated book offers many simple, fun activities to teach youngsters the fundamentals of geography. The games & activities are organized around 5 specific themes: Where are things located? What characteristics make a place special? What are relationships among people & places? What are the patterns of movement of people, products & information? & How can the earth be divided show more into regions for study? Includes a glossary, suggested readings, & a guide to free or inexpensive materials. show less
